The Director, Legal Operating Model, AI & Transformation is responsible for helping the Legal & Government Affairs leadership team successfully execute its strategic priorities and continuously improve how legal, regulatory, litigation, and public policy services are delivered.
This is a highly execution-oriented leadership role. The successful candidate will partner closely with department leadership to translate strategy into action, coordinate complex cross-functional initiatives, drive adoption of new capabilities, and deliver measurable improvements in legal quality, client service, productivity, operational effectiveness, and organizational performance.
The role serves as a catalyst for change and continuous improvement across the department. Working through influence rather than direct authority, the Director will help align stakeholders, remove barriers to execution, establish accountability, and ensure strategic initiatives achieve intended outcomes.
The role also serves as the department’s leader for the responsible adoption, integration, and scaling of artificial intelligence capabilities, helping legal teams incorporate AI into legal workflows, knowledge systems, service delivery models, and decision-making processes in ways that improve legal quality, efficiency, consistency, and client experience while maintaining appropriate governance and professional standards.
Success in this role will be measured not by plans created, presentations delivered, technologies implemented, or pilot programs launched. Success will be measured by improvements successfully adopted, sustained, and translated into measurable business outcomes.
In this role, you will serve as LGA’s central source of expertise to:
Process map workflows across the LGA department;
Ideate solutions to enhance quality, strategic capacity and/or efficiency through redesigned workflows, processes, or use of technology (including AI);
Partner with others on the creation, implementation, and adoption of these solutions;
Advance the responsible, scalable, and measurable use of lean processes, legal technology, and AI solutions; and
Support appropriate governance, human oversight, and alignment to Schwab’s risk, compliance, and technology standards.
You will report directly to the Head of Legal Operations and Strategic Initiatives (LOSI) and will serve as a member of the LOSI leadership team.
